Trying to outrun radiation

http://blogs.aljazeera.net/asia/2011/03/16/trying-outrun-radiation


-snip-

Traffic through the city is sparse, store shelves are light on the basics and expats are leaving in droves, with several countries - such as Germany and France - advising their nationals to leave.

The Japanese aren't leaving the country. They are, however, hedging their bets and moving as far as they can from the potential path of radioactive winds that might blow down from the exploding and burning nuclear plants in Fukushima.

The trains leaving Tokyo to Osaka and Kyoto are packed, mostly with families with small children and elderly members.

A train crew member on the way to Kyoto told me that trains heading to Tokyo are unusually empty, and the ones heading out are packed.

-snip-

Meanwhile, Mitsue Terado, 35, said outright that she "did not believe the government" when it said that radiation levels were safe.

She travelled to Osaka from Ibaraki prefecture, with her mother and three children, as her earthquake-affected home had no water.
